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ations, Park has developed a "Method and Apparatus for Searching Pattern in Sequence Data." This inventive method encompasses the establishment of multiple interest pattern models, each defined by parameters such as interest pattern length, allowed mismatch value, and minimum support. The process calculates the support of a candidate pattern generated within the specified interest pattern length, determining if it meets the requisite conditions for minimum support.

Another notable patent is the "Method and Apparatus for High-Dimensional Data Visualization." This invention offers a novel approach to visualize high-dimensional data by initially presenting it at a lower dimension. Subsequently, it enhances visualization by providing insights in a higher dimensional area of the first visualization, creating a comprehensive understanding of complex data sets.
